Statutes Text

Article - State Government




§8–402.

    (a)    The General Assembly finds that:

        (1)    a framework that allows for periodic, legislative review of the regulatory, licensing, and other governmental activities of the Executive Branch of the State government is essential for the maintenance of a government in which the citizens have confidence and of a healthy State economy; and

        (2)    this legislative review is consistent with other activities and goals of the General Assembly.

    (b)    The purposes of this subtitle are to:

        (1)    establish a system of legislative review that will:

            (i)    determine whether a governmental activity is necessary for the public interest; and

            (ii)    make units that are responsible for necessary governmental activities accountable and responsive to the public interest; and

        (2)    ensure that the legislative review takes place by establishing, by statute, a process for the review and other legislative action.
